The cheapest way to get from Freshwater to Liverpool is to ferry and bus which costs £45 - £120 and takes 11h 8m.
The fastest way to get from Freshwater to Liverpool is to ferry and fly and train which takes 6h 31m and costs £95 - £230.
The distance between Freshwater and Liverpool is 261 miles.
The best way to get from Freshwater to Liverpool without a car is to ferry and train which takes 6h 38m and costs £85 - £250.
It takes approximately 6h 38m to get from Freshwater to Liverpool, including transfers.

There is no direct connection from Freshwater to Liverpool. However, you can take the taxi to Red Jet Ferry Terminal, take the ferry to Southampton Passenger Ferry Terminal, walk to Red Jet Terminal, take the bus to ASDA & Marlands, walk to Southampton Central, take the train to Birmingham New Street, then take the train to Liverpool Lime Street. Alternatively, you can take a bus from School Green Road to Liverpool, Liverpool One via Bus Station, Yarmouth IOW Ferry Terminal, Lymington Pier Ferry Terminal, Main Post Office, Marlands, Coach Station, and Birmingham Coach Station in around 11h 8m.
